Required Travel Documentation

The required travel documentation for the Qatar eVisa ensures a smooth application process. Here is a table outlining the essential documents needed:

DocumentDescription
Valid PassportThe passport must be valid for at least six months.
Hotel BookingConfirmed reservation through Discover Qatar.
Return TicketProof of onward travel to your home country.
Financial ProofBank statement or cash showing sufficient funds.
Passport-Sized PhotoA recent clear photo for the application.

Visa Exempt Programs and waiver programs

Qatar has visa exemptions and waiver programs for some travelers. Citizens from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) countries do not need a visa to enter. This includes people from Saudi Arabia, the UAE, Kuwait, Oman, and Bahrain. They can visit Qatar easily and stay for as long as they wish.

Many countries benefit from a visa waiver program. Travelers from these nations can stay in Qatar for a short time without applying for a visa. This makes visiting Qatar quick and simple for them. It is important to check if your country is on this list before planning a trip.

Processing Times and Fees

Understanding the processing times and fees for the Qatar eVisa is important for travelers. Here is a table summarizing this information:

Visa TypeProcessing TimeFee
Standard eVisa1 to 3 business daysApproximately $30
Urgent eVisaWithin 24 hoursApproximately $70
Tourist Visa on ArrivalN/AFree for eligible countries

Extension and Overstay Information

Travelers may need to extend their Qatar eVisa in some situations. An extension can allow more time to explore or complete the business. To apply for an extension, a request must be made at the Ministry of Interior. This should be done before the visa expires.

Overstaying the eVisa can lead to serious problems. Fines may occur for each day of overstay. It is important to know that immigration authorities can take action. This may include a ban on returning to Qatar for a period of time.

How much is a 2-year work visa in Qatar?

The base fee for a two-year employment visa in Qatar is QAR 852.80. Additional costs include medical tests (QAR 100–300) and residence permits (approximately QAR 1,000 for two years.
